Dark colors can look great on short nails, as they can create a chic and sophisticated look. Dark nail polishes, such as deep reds, blues, purples, and blacks, can help make short nails appear longer and more elegant. This is because dark colors tend to create the illusion of length and can make the nails look sleek and well-manicured. Additionally, dark nail polishes can be versatile and can be worn for both casual and formal occasions. They can also make a bold statement and add a pop of color to any outfit. However, it is important to keep in mind that dark colors can sometimes show imperfections more easily, so it is important to properly prep the nails before applying the polish. This includes shaping the nails, pushing back the cuticles, and applying a base coat to create a smooth surface. Overall, dark colors can be a great choice for short nails and can help enhance their appearance with a touch of sophistication.
